Transaction 8ecbaa37266f388a58afb05ea5efec6c4a9bcee4deea4649a317122cb8889708
1 Input
1 Output
-
8ecbaa37266f388a58afb05ea5efec6c4a9bcee4deea4649a317122cb8889708:0
- value
- 324825
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c07f3f3f4629dc9b42de8426af96a38848cbda9 OP_EQUAL
- address
- 3JqEVBrQ6JWw3VsZTYksBfew5dMdVwwQkC